European Roulette Rules Breakdown

European roulette is notable among roulette game types because of its straightforward rules and unique features. The game is played on a wheel that features 37 pockets, numbered from 0 to 36. In contrast to its American counterpart, European roulette does not have a double zero, which marginally improves the player's odds. Players can position a variety of bets, including single numbers, colors, and groups of numbers. The house edge is typically 2.7%, making it beneficial for players. Moreover, the "La Partage" rule may apply, enabling players to get back half their bet on even-money wagers if the ball lands on zero. This feature improves the tactical appeal of the game, making it attractive to both newcomers and veteran gamblers.

American Roulette Differences Highlighted

Whereas both American and European roulette share core gameplay mechanics, several key differences distinguish them. The most significant difference is the layout of the wheel and the presence of an additional pocket in American roulette. This variant features 38 pockets, including numbers 1 to 36, a single zero (0), and a double zero (00), while European roulette has only 37 pockets with a single zero. This extra pocket elevates the house edge for American roulette, making it less favorable for players. Furthermore, betting options may change slightly, with American roulette offering exclusive bets such as the "five-number bet." Understanding these differences is essential for players seeking to optimize their strategies and elevate their gaming experience.

Distinctive Characteristics of French Roulette

French roulette distinguishes itself from other variants through its distinctive rules and characteristics that improve the gaming experience. One notable aspect is the "La Partage" rule, which allows players to reclaim half their bet if the ball lands on zero, reducing the house edge. Additionally, the layout of the French roulette wheel includes only a single zero, unlike its American counterpart, which has both a single and double zero. This layout further decreases the house edge. The game likewise provides special betting alternatives, like "Voisins du Zero" and "Tiers du Cylindre," which facilitate more strategic gaming. These factors merge to deliver a more compelling and potentially profitable gaming experience for players.

Effective Strategies for Succeeding in Online Roulette

Many players seek winning strategies to elevate their winning odds at online roulette. One popular approach is the Martingale strategy, where players increase twofold their bets after each loss, attempting to get back previous losses with a single win. However, this method necessitates a considerable bankroll and can cause notable risks if a streak of defeats occurs.

A further successful strategy is the D'Alembert system, which involves increasing bets by one unit after a loss and diminishing by one unit after a win. This approach is less aggressive than Martingale, possibly offering a more secure betting experience.

Furthermore, players can consider making bets on even-money selections, such as red or black, which provide better chances additional information of winning, even though with lower payouts. Understanding the odds and variations of roulette games, such as European and American, also plays a crucial role in formulating effective strategies for online gameplay.

What's the House Edge in Online Roulette?

The house edge in online roulette varies by variant; European roulette commonly carries a 2.7% house edge, while the American version, featuring an extra double zero, carries a higher edge of around 5.26%, directly affecting player returns.

What Makes Live Dealer Roulette Games Work?

Live dealer roulette games function via real-time video streaming of a physical roulette table. A live dealer spins the wheel, and players make wagers digitally, blending the excitement of traditional casinos with online convenience.
